【Java】線程池排隊策略 & 拒絕策略

一、爲何JDK1.5引入線程池 在Java中,若是每一個任務都建立一個新的thread,開銷是很是大的。除了建立和銷燬線程的時間開銷外,還消耗大量的系統資源。爲了規避以上問題,儘量減小建立和銷燬線程的次數,特別是一些資源耗費比較大的線程的建立和銷燬,儘可能利用已有的線程對象來進行服務,這就是線程池引入的緣由。  java 二、ThreadPoolExecutor類分析 (a)ThreadPoolE
相關文章
相關標籤/搜索